Angel D. Sappa; Cristhian A. Aguilera; Juan A. Carvajal Ayala; Miguel Oliveira; Dennis Romero; Boris X. Vintimilla; Ricardo Toledo |
Title  |
Monocular visual odometry: a cross-spectral image fusion based approach |
Type |
Journal Article |
Year |
2016 |
Publication |
Robotics and Autonomous Systems Journal |
Abbreviated Journal |
|
Volume |
Vol. 86 |
Issue |
|
Pages |
pp. 26-36 |
Keywords |
Monocular visual odometry LWIR-RGB cross-spectral imaging Image fusion |
Abstract |
This manuscript evaluates the usage of fused cross-spectral images in a monocular visual odometry approach. Fused images are obtained through a Discrete Wavelet Transform (DWT) scheme, where the best setup is em- pirically obtained by means of a mutual information based evaluation met- ric. The objective is to have a exible scheme where fusion parameters are adapted according to the characteristics of the given images. Visual odom- etry is computed from the fused monocular images using an off the shelf approach. Experimental results using data sets obtained with two different platforms are presented. Additionally, comparison with a previous approach as well as with monocular-visible/infrared spectra are also provided showing the advantages of the proposed scheme. |

Byron Lima; Ricardo Cajo; Victor Huilcapi; Wilton Agila |
Title  |
Modeling and comparative study of linear and nonlinear controllers for rotary inverted pendulum |
Type |
Conference Article |
Year |
2017 |
Publication |
Journal of Physics: Conference Series |
Abbreviated Journal |
|
Volume |
783 |
Issue |
|
Pages |
|
Keywords |
|
Abstract |
The rotary inverted pendulum (RIP) is a problem difficult to control, several studies have been conducted where different control techniques have been applied. Literature reports that, although problem is nonlinear, classical PID controllers presents appropriate performances when applied to the system. In this paper, a comparative study of the performances of linear and nonlinear PID structures is carried out. The control algorithms are evaluated in the RIP system, using indices of performance and power consumption, which allow the categorization of control strategies according to their performance. This article also presents the modeling system, which has been estimated some of the parameters involved in the RIP system, using computer-aided design tools (CAD) and experimental methods or techniques proposed by several authors attended. The results indicate a better performance of the nonlinear controller with an increase in the robustness and faster response than the linear controller |

Cristhian A. Aguilera; Cristhian Aguilera; Angel D. Sappa |
Title  |
Melamine faced panels defect classification beyond the visible spectrum. |
Type |
Journal Article |
Year |
2018 |
Publication |
In Sensors 2018 |
Abbreviated Journal |
|
Volume |
Vol. 11 |
Issue |
Issue 11 |
Pages |
|
Keywords |
|
Abstract |
In this work, we explore the use of images from different spectral bands to classify defects in melamine faced panels, which could appear through the production process. Through experimental evaluation, we evaluate the use of images from the visible (VS), near-infrared (NIR), and long wavelength infrared (LWIR), to classify the defects using a feature descriptor learning approach together with a support vector machine classifier. Two descriptors were evaluated, Extended Local Binary Patterns (E-LBP) and SURF using a Bag of Words (BoW) representation. The evaluation was carried on with an image set obtained during this work, which contained five different defect categories that currently occurs in the industry. Results show that using images from beyond
the visual spectrum helps to improve classification performance in contrast with a single visible spectrum solution. |
